Output 213486e19fae142f2ab5b63996438b7be432d3f05980c01899cc6d708769fa8e:0

value
19369120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ad70430121c156ae2b7d28667f8c1e635d61d449 OP_EQUALVERIFY OP_CHECKSIG
address
Lb31eUuAFPnZwhFHZLznEexAQ5A4sX365M
transaction
213486e19fae142f2ab5b63996438b7be432d3f05980c01899cc6d708769fa8e
spent
true